bsmith6470 09-17-2010 03:14 PM

Quote:

Originally Posted by NWilz (Post 3756956)
are 5 disc cases any wider?

The Elite style cases are the same size for 1 to 3 disks. I have 1. 2, 3 and 5-disk cases. The 5-disk case MIGHT be a millimeter wider, but for all purposes are the same size.

Hope this helps.
